This class can be enjoyed by everyone. The cost of the class includes instruction and materials to create one open bowl form about 6″ diameter. Price of the course includes shipping, as firing takes three days. Finished pieces will be shipped the following week.

Participants will start the day working on a wax bowl form, creating texture and pattern on a ready made form. They will then cast a mold of the form and apply the glass into it. The pieces will be put in the kiln and fired.
